Finding your way to Kalymnos ferry port
To reach the Kalymnos ferry port, head to Pothia, the island’s capital, which is a short walk from the city center. The ferry terminal is conveniently located near local shops and restaurants. You can get there by taxi, which is readily available and takes about 10 minutes from the airport, or by local bus service if schedules align.
In Amorgos, the Katapola ferry terminal is situated near the village of Katapola, close to popular accommodations and restaurants. This terminal is easily accessible from both the beach and the village center.

Exploring Katapola, Amorgos
Katapola, a charming village on the island of Amorgos in Greece, is a special place waiting for you to explore. With its beautiful blue sea and white-washed houses, it feels like stepping into a postcard. You can’t miss the famous Monastery of Hozoviotissa, which clings to the cliff and offers amazing views. The beaches, like Agioi Saranta, are perfect for splashing in the waves or relaxing in the sun.
Besides enjoying the beach, you can try delicious local food, like fresh seafood and tasty Greek pastries at cozy tavernas. If you like walking, there are lovely trails that take you through nature, revealing hidden spots and breathtaking views.
